Product Overview

 The Brocade Compatible 100G-QSFP28-LR4-LP-10KM is a premium 100G QSFP28 transceiver LR4, designed for high-speed 100Gbps connectivity up to 10km. Optimized for high-density data centers, this 10km LAN-WDM single-mode 100G QSFP28 Transceiver LR4 duplex LC utilizes Single-Mode Fiber (SMF) and LAN-WDM technology(wavelength:1295~1310nm) to ensure superior signal integrity. It features low power consumption, low latency and operates within a commercial temperature range (0°C to 70°C) for maximum reliability. Key Technical Specifications

This factory-calibrated low-power 100G QSFP28 Transceiver LR4 features ultra-low thermal dissipation and multi-lane signal recovery, fully matching electrical, optical and power parameters of Brocade 100G-QSFP28-LR4-LP-10KM. Supporting hot plug-and-play in high-density rack deployments, it provides low-jitter long-reach transmission for Brocade SLX & FC series data center single-mode networking projects.
Brocade  Compatible 100G-QSFP28-LR4-LP-10KM Vendor Name HYTOPTODEVICE
Form Factor QSFP28 Max Data Rate 103.125Gbps (4x 25.78Gbps)
Wavelength 1295.56nm,1300.05nm,
1304.58nm,1309.14nm
Max Distance 10km
Connector Duplex LC Transmitter Type 4 x LAN WDM EML
Cable Type SMF Receiver Type PIN
Modulation (Electrical) 4x 25G-NRZ TX Power -4.3~+4.5dBm
Power Consumption < 3.5W Receiver Sensitivity < -10.6dBm
Protocols 100G Ethernet, MSA Compliant Operation Temperature 0 to 70°C (32 to 158°F)

FAQ

Q1: Can HYTOPTODEVICE calibrated 100G QSFP28 Transceiver LR4 run without alarms on multi-brand Cisco, Arista and Juniper enterprise switches?
A: Most generic third-party optical modules will trigger unsupported transceiver CLI warnings, while our 100G QSFP28 Transceiver LR4 supports customized vendor EEPROM coding to skip OEM transceiver restriction blocks for smooth cross-brand deployment.

Q2: Is field re-programming available for 100G QSFP28 Transceiver LR4 when users replace existing switch vendors later?
A: Field re-coding is supported, yet professional dedicated programming equipment such as Flexbox optical coding tools is required, which we can supply alongside our bulk 100G QSFP28 Transceiver LR4 orders.

Q3: What minimum fiber span is required to protect built-in receiver chips of industrial compatible 100G QSFP28 Transceiver LR4?
A: Our PIN receiver version 100G QSFP28 Transceiver LR4 has no minimum transmission distance limit. Models fitted with high-sensitivity APD receivers need minimum 2km fiber or matched fixed attenuators to prevent receiver burnout from excessive optical input power.

Q4: How do aging fiber cables and stacked patch panels impact the rated 10km transmission range of 100G QSFP28 Transceiver LR4?
A: Each patch panel brings 0.5dB–0.75dB extra insertion loss, which consumes the module’s optical power budget and reduces the maximum stable transmission distance of our 100G QSFP28 Transceiver LR4.

Q5: Why does long-reach 100G QSFP28 Transceiver LR4 generate more heat than short-range SR4 and CWDM4 optical modules?
A: Our 100G QSFP28 Transceiver LR4 adopts EML lasers and integrated MUX/DEMUX components, which consume higher power to support 10km long-distance transmission, resulting in higher operating temperature versus short-reach transceivers.

Q6: What standard transmit and receive optical power thresholds apply to factory-tested 100G QSFP28 Transceiver LR4?
A: The standard Tx power range of our 100G QSFP28 Transceiver LR4 is -4.3 dBm ~ +4.5 dBm, and the normal Rx power operating window falls between -10.6 dBm and +4.5 dBm for error-free 10km links.

Q7: Is optical interconnection feasible between standard 100G QSFP28 Transceiver LR4 and 100G 4WDM-10 single-mode modules over 10km fiber?
A: Yes. The 100G 4WDM-10 standard is designed for full optical interoperability with our IEEE-compliant 100G QSFP28 Transceiver LR4 on all 10km single-mode link deployments.

Q8: How vulnerable are LC optical end faces of 100G QSFP28 Transceiver LR4 to dust and surface contaminants?
A: The 4-wavelength parallel optical structure makes our 100G QSFP28 Transceiver LR4 extremely sensitive to tiny dust particles. Micro contaminants can block one signal lane, cut 25% traffic capacity or fully disconnect the fiber link.

Q9: What leads to early service failure of ordinary 100G QSFP28 Transceiver LR4 within 1 to 2 years of operation?
A: Premature breakdown within two years mostly stems from fast EML laser aging caused by poor thermal design and low-grade internal IC chips. Our HYTOPTODEVICE 100G QSFP28 Transceiver LR4 uses optimized heat dissipation to extend service life.

Q10: What practical methods can identify counterfeit or second-hand refurbished OEM 100G QSFP28 Transceiver LR4 modules?
A: You can inspect blurry label printing and scratched module housings, or cross-check DOM runtime data and serial numbers against the official OEM database to filter fake or refurbished LR4 transceivers.
